An Admissions Associate is a data entry position that oversees the in-patient, bed assignments, and completion of preliminary paperwork for entering patients. Works with medical, nursing and accounting staff to ensure appropriate patient placement. Additionally, Admissions Associate confirms that all insurance benefits coverage meets standards of admission as dictated by policy. Responsibilities

  • Data entry and communication with insurance companies.
  • Work with Admissions Director to admit patients to facility, verify insurance eligibility, etc.
  • Expedites flow of admissions through timely decision making and collaboration with all involved parties as necessary.
  • Obtain verification or authorization of payment source(s)
  • Document referrals and outcomes of each potential referral
  • Maintain Admission Log
  • Understand the impact of reimbursement for various payer sources including, but not limited to, Medicare, MaineCare and Managed Care.
  • Maintain daily census and mix goals per facility budget.
  • Produce required reports, summaries and recommendations.
  • Communicate admission information to facilities in a timely manner.
  • Obtains pre-certification from insurance companies, as needed
